Betches Signs With CAA for Entertainment Representation

Betches, a leading entertainment brand targeting millennial and Gen Z women, has signed with Creative Artists Agency (CAA) for representation. CAA will help expand Betches' creator-led, social-first presence into linear television, streaming, film, live experiences, and global brand partnerships. The agency will work with Betches' internal teams to package the brand's portfolio of comedy creators, podcasts (including U Up?, Mention It All, and Style Thera), and original programming.
